Upon completion of AutoCAD
2007 Level 1, students will be able to create a basic
2D drawing using drawing and editing tools, organize
drawing objects on layers, add text and basic dimensions,
and prepare to plot. For maximum flexibility, the course
is divided into two parts; the first presenting essential
skills, the second covering more sophisticated techniques
for drawing setup and productivity. The two parts combined
fulfill the requirements for AutoCAD Level 1.
Topics
include:
Essentials
•
Understanding
the AutoCAD workspace and user interface
•
Using
basic drawing, editing, and viewing tools
•
Organizing
drawing objects on layers
•
Inserting
reuseable symbols (blocks)
•
Preparing
a layout to be plotted
•
Adding
text, hatching, and dimensions
Beyond
the Basics
•
Using
more advanced editing and construction techniques
•
Creating
local and global blocks
•
Setting
up layers, styles, and templates
